I wanted to talk about black and white images. More specifically when do I convert a colored image to black and white. The answer is simple. If the image is more powerful as a B&W then I convert. If it doesn't add to the photo or it detracts from the photo then I leave it in color. In these particular images, I felt they were more powerful as B&W. There is some cool patterns going on along the back wall but the foam was a vibrant green color. In color it distracted the eye from the focus (Brock and his guitar). In B&W it was less distracting and the pattern was move obvious and interesting.

52 Week Photo Project
Last year I thought it would be fun to participate in a 52 week photo challenge. {A 52 week photo challenge is when you take a picture and post it on your blog every week. There is usually a theme for each week's post} The only problem was that I didn't stick with it. Which I regret because the pictures I did take I loved. So this year I am recruiting my friends, family, acquaintances and anyone else who wants to participate to join with me. You can all hold me accountable and I you. Why should you participate?
- If you are like me you take fewer and fewer pictures of your kids, family and everyday life and want to change that.
- If you are like me you have become a terrible blogger and where my blog is my family journal that means I am also a terrible journal keeper so taking pictures and posting them every week will help us accomplish two goals at once.
- You want to improve your photography no matter what kind of camera you use and the key to being a better photographer is PRACTICE!
- It will just be fun and you will have a treasure of photos after the 52 weeks.
I have put together a 52 week schedule (bottom of this post) and I am setting up a weekly post on this blog where you will be able to post a link to your blog post each week. This way we can all see what everyone is doing and hopefully this will help keep us motivated. Here are a few more details that will hopefully answer any questions you might have:- Do I need a fancy DSLR camera to participate? - Of course not! You can use any camera you want - iphone, point and shoot, DSLR etc. I don't care what you use just make sure it is your own work.
- Do I need to stick to the weekly themes or prompts? No. I have put together a schedule with weekly themes that are merely suggestions and to help get the creative juices flowing. You are welcome to pick your own topic or just post a favorite picture from the week. The point is to document your life and what is most important to you. Having a topic or theme will hopefully add variety and encourage creativity.
- Be Creative! Not only with the topic or theme for the week but also how you take the picture. Consider shooting from different angles - high, low, close up or even far away. Ask yourself "How would I normally take this picture?" and then try shooting from a different position.
